Secure QR Share
HOW IT WORKS
1. Sender enters text or a password and chooses a shared PIN.
2. The app encrypts the payload with AES-256 and displays a QR code.
3. Receiver scans the code with Secure QR Share, enters the same PIN, and the original text is instantly decrypted and copied to the clipboard.
FEATURES
• AES-256-CBC encryption with PIN-derived keys — no server, no cloud
• Works fully offline — no internet permission required at runtime
• Share sheet integration — highlight text anywhere and share directly into the app
• App Links support — QR codes can be opened from the camera or browser
• Optional unencrypted mode for non-sensitive public links
• No ads, no tracking, no analytics, no accounts
PRIVACY
Secure QR Share never transmits your data. Everything is processed locally on your device. The encryption key is derived from your PIN and never stored or sent anywhere.
OPEN SOURCE
The full source code is available on GitHub under the MIT license.
- Author: Jonathan Drolet
- License: MIT License
- Issue Tracker
- Source Code
- Build Metadata
- Reproducibility Status
Donate
Versions
Although APK downloads are available below to give you the choice, you should be aware that by installing that way you will not receive update notifications and it's a less secure way to download. We recommend that you install the F-Droid client and use that.
Download F-Droid-
x86_64This version requires Android 7.0 or newer.
It is built and signed by F-Droid, and guaranteed to correspond to this source tarball.
Download APK 20 MiB PGP Signature | Build Log
-
arm64-v8aThis version requires Android 7.0 or newer.
It is built and signed by F-Droid, and guaranteed to correspond to this source tarball.
Download APK 19 MiB PGP Signature | Build Log
-
armeabi-v7aThis version requires Android 7.0 or newer.
It is built and signed by F-Droid, and guaranteed to correspond to this source tarball.
Download APK 16 MiB PGP Signature | Build Log





